Certainly, smoking cannabis flower which contains THCA actively turns it into Delta-nine THC as you smoke it. As stated higher than, it really is the application of warmth expected with the decarboxylation process, which is strictly what comes about when you implement an open flame to the cannabis flower.

You may perhaps know that Delta-nine THC would be the material that Does thca turn into delta9 when smoked will get you high, but what about THCA? Each of those cannabinoids are integral elements of the cannabis plant, and in reality, the previous turns into the latter.

We’ll delve into this more during the write-up, but it can be crucial you understand that THCA is non-psychoactive. Due to size of this compound’s molecule, it are unable to bind to CB1 and CB2 receptors, and therefore, it gained’t get you significant unless it turns into Delta-9 THC.
